Fiesta, Everest help drive overall Ford sales up 23 percent in April

Ford Everest
Ford Fiesta

Ford Group Philippines (FGP) reported overall April sales for Ford brand vehicles that rose 23 percent from the same month last year to 764 units. Ford's robust performance in April was led by the continued strength of demand for the all-new Ford Fiesta and popular Ford Everest SUV.

The globally award-winning Fiesta, which continued to enjoy strong demand from an increasing number of new-to-Ford customers, delivered April sales of 283 units. The Fiesta added another prestigious accolade in April to its growing worldwide collection by being named 'Best Sub-Compact' in the 2011 Philippine Car of the Year Awards.

"The new Fiesta is increasingly being recognized as one of the clear leaders in the highly competitive B-segment -- both by Filipino customers who are continuing to drive strong sales of this fantastic car, as well as respected independent parties who are endorsing the Fiesta with things like the Car of the Year award," said Randy Krieger, president of Ford Group Philippines.

Ford's April performance was also supported by strong contribution from the Ford Everest with sales of 227 units. Year-to-date sales of the consistently performing Everest have climbed 36 percent from a year ago to 946 units.

Overall sales of Ford-brand vehicles in the Philippines through the first four months of the year have risen an impressive 58 percent versus the same period a year ago to 3,151 vehicles.

"The success of Fiesta is continuing to drive our sales gains this year, but it's also being supported by solid performances across our entire lineup of Ford vehicles. We're determined to continue building on this success, and further expanding our customer opportunity with attractive promotions like our current 'Drive One' campaign in showrooms nationwide," explained Krieger.

Enhanced customer service experience

FGP has also continued to enhance its leading aftersales service offering and customer experience with the launch of its Ford Service Promo for owners of Ford Focus, Ford Escape, Ford Everest and Ford Ranger units sold from 2004 to 2007 whose warranties have expired.

The Ford Service promotion includes a free oil filter to out-of-warranty Ford owners who will avail of the Periodic Maintenance Service during the month of May, as well as a 15 percent discount on all parts and labor.

"This new campaign will help further strengthen our leading cost-of-ownership equation and help our customers continue to feel the difference of today's Ford," added Krieger.
